Our Policies
-
All services are HIPAA-compliant. Client information is kept confidential and secure in accordance with ethical and legal standards.
-
We require 24 hours’ notice to cancel or reschedule an appointment. No-shows or late cancellations may be subject to the full session fee, except in emergencies.
-
At this time, services are private pay. We’re happy to provide a superbill if your insurance company accepts out-of-network reimbursement for music therapy.
-
Rates vary based on session length, location, and service type. Contact us directly for a personalized quote or to discuss sliding scale options.
